Connaissances Informatiques >> programmation >> Programmation Java >> Content
  Derniers articles
  • Comment remplacer une fonction en Ja…
  • Qu'est-ce qu'une déclaration en Jav…
  • Comparaison des plates-formes Java &…
  • Comment remplacer une balle qui rebo…
  • Parse, méthode en Java 
  • Java est un langage fortement typé …
  • Comment créer un menu de restaurant…
  • Comment parcourir une liste en JSP 
  • Comment utiliser Typecast en Java 
  • Exceptions définies par l'utilisate…
  •   Programmation Java
  • C /C + + Programming

  • Computer Programming Languages

  • Delphi Programming

  • Programmation Java

  • Programmation JavaScript

  • PHP /MySQL Programmation

  • programmation Perl

  • Programmation Python

  • Ruby Programming

  • Visual Basics programmation
  •  
    Programmation Java

    Comment convertir Java à PHP

    Java et PHP sont deux des langages de programmation les plus utilisés aujourd'hui. Bien que les deux technologies offrent des fonctionnalités avancées et portabilité dynamique , transformant l'un à l' autre n'est pas encore tout à fait possible . Les bonnes nouvelles sont cependant que des classes Java et PHP peuvent être intégrés pour former des applications performantes , comme pour le calcul de la taxe de vente . Le script principal doit être utilisé pour ce projet d'intégration PHP- Java est un script PHP et le compilateur sera Java. Instructions
    1

    Collez le code ci-dessous pour créer votre compilateur Java, dont vous aurez besoin pour compiler votre projet salesTax.java dans le script PHP: .

    Import java.util * ; Photos

    java.text d'importation * ; .

    public class SalesTax {

    public string SalesTax ( prix double , double SalesTax )

    {
    < p> la double imposition = prix * SalesTax ;

    NumberFormat NumberFormatter ;

    NumberFormatter = NumberFormat.getCurrencyInstance ();

    cordes priceOut = numberFormatter.format (prix ) ; < br >

    cordes taxOut = numberFormatter.format ( impôts) ;

    NumberFormatter = NumberFormat.getPercentInstance ();

    cordes salesTaxOut =

    numberFormatter.format ( SalesTax ) ; Photos

    String str = " Une taxe sur les ventes de " + + salesTaxOut

    " sur" + priceOut + " égaux " + taxOut + "." ;

    str de retour;

    } }


    2

    utiliser PHP pour appeler le code compilé appelé SalesTaxInterface.php . Cette fonction permet de calculer les données entrées par l'utilisateur dans le formulaire HTML :

    < php

    //Format de la forme HTML

    $ salesTaxForm = << . ; < SalesTaxForm


    Prix (ex. 42.56 ) :


    taux de la taxe de vente

    (ex. 0,06) :

    = nom de «texte» = taille " d'impôt " maxlength = "15" = valeur "15" = "" > Photos

    value = " Calculer ! "> Photos

    Photos

    SalesTaxForm ;

    if ( isset ($ soumettre ) !) :

    écho $ salesTaxForm ;

    autre : .

    //Instancier la classe SalesTax

    SalesTax $ = new Java ( " SalesTax ");

    //Don 't oublier de transtyper afin de

    //conforme aux spécifications de méthode Java

    $ prix = (double) $ des prix; .

    $ taxes = (double) $ taxes ;

    print $ SalesTax -> SalesTax ($ prix , $ taxes ) ;

    endif ; ?

    >
    3

    Ajoutez le code suivant à votre projet de pont Java et PHP ainsi :

    # /bin /env php

    < php

    require_once ( " java /Java.inc ");

    include (" wsimport.php ");

    try {

    $ addNumbersService = new Java ( " org.duke.AddNumbersService " ) ;

    $ port = $ addNumbersService -> getAddNumbersPort ();

    $ nombre1 = 10;

    $ nombre2 = 20;

    écho ( " . . Invoquant opération à sens unique Rien n'est renvoyé du service \\ n") ;

    $ Port- > oneWayInt (nombre1 $ ) ​​;

    echo ( " addNumbers Invocation ( nombre1 $ , number2 $ ) \\ n ") ;

    $ result = $ portuaires -> addNumbers ( nombre1 $ , number2 $ ) ;

    echo (" Le résultat de l'addition numéro1 de dollars et est number2 $ result \\ n \\ n ");


    $ nombre1 = -10 ;

    echo (" addNumbers Invocation ( nombre1 $ , number2 $ ) \\ n ") ;

    $ result = $ Port- > addNumbers ( nombre1 $ , number2 $ );

    echo (" Le résultat de l'addition nombre1 et nombre2 $ $ est $ result \\ n \\ n");

    } catch ( JavaException $ ex) {

    $ ex = $ ex -> getCause ();

    if ( java_instanceof ($ ex , java ( " org.duke.AddNumbersFault_Exception " ) )) {


    $ info = $ ex -> getFaultInfo () -> getFaultInfo ();

    echo (" Caught AddNumbersFault_Exception $ ex, INFO: $ info \\ n ". ) ;

    } else {

    echo (" exception s'est produite : $ ex \\ n") ; }


    }

    > Photos

     
    Article précédent:
    Article suivant:
    Articles recommandés
  • Comment faire un Boolean privé en Java 
  • Quatre types primitifs en Java 
  • Comment puis-je obtenir une gamme de valeurs à partir de la liste triée en Java 
  • Android UI Développement 
  • Comment accéder à une API LinkedIn Du Android 
  • Comment fermer une JFrame en Java avec un bouton 
  • Comment créer un menu en programmation Android 
  • Comment obtenir un flux de sortie d'une URL en Java 
  • Comment repeindre un problème sur Java 
  • Comment faire énumération des types de données en Java 
  • Connaissances Informatiques © http://www.ordinateur.cc